Learn more about Bing search results hereOrganizing and summarizing search results for youPhyllite and schist are two types of metamorphic rock that share the same formation process. Phyllite is the precursor to schist, and experiences less heat, chemical activity and pressure than schist. Schist is formed by dynamic metamorphism at high temperatures and pressures that aligns the grains of mica, hornblende and other elongated minerals into thin layers. Phyllite is a shiny version of slate, and has a subtle shine because the original clay minerals in the shale have transformed into small mica minerals.3 Sources Phyllite - Wikipedia
